Siemens SIMATIC S7-1200 Manual De Sistema página 11

Ocultar thumbs Ver también para SIMATIC S7-1200:
Tabla de contenido

Publicidad

8.7
Conversión ...................................................................................................................... 284
8.7.1
CONV (convertir valor) ..................................................................................................... 284
8.7.2
Instrucciones de conversión de SCL .................................................................................. 285
8.7.3
ROUND (redondear número) y TRUNC (truncar a entero) .................................................. 288
8.7.4
inferior) ........................................................................................................................... 289
8.7.5
SCALE_X (escalar) y NORM_X (normalizar) ....................................................................... 290
8.7.6
Instrucciones de conversión Variant ................................................................................. 293
8.7.6.1
VARIANT_TO_DB_ANY (convertir VARIANT en DB_ANY) ..................................................... 293
8.7.6.2
DB_ANY_TO_VARIANT (convertir DB_ANY en VARIANT) ..................................................... 294
8.8
Control del programa ....................................................................................................... 295
8.8.1
8.8.2
JMP_LIST (definir lista de saltos) ....................................................................................... 296
8.8.3
SWITCH (distribuidor de saltos)......................................................................................... 297
8.8.4
RET (retroceder)............................................................................................................... 299
8.8.5
ENDIS_PW (limitar y habilitar legitimación de la contraseña)............................................. 300
8.8.6
RE_TRIGR (reiniciar tiempo de vigilancia del ciclo)............................................................. 303
8.8.7
STP (finalizar programa) ................................................................................................... 304
8.8.8
8.8.9
RUNTIME (medir tiempo de ejecución) ............................................................................. 307
8.8.10
Instrucciones de control del programa de SCL................................................................... 309
8.8.10.1
8.8.10.2
Instrucción IF-THEN.......................................................................................................... 310
8.8.10.3
Instrucción CASE.............................................................................................................. 311
8.8.10.4
Instrucción FOR................................................................................................................ 312
8.8.10.5
Instrucción WHILE-DO ...................................................................................................... 313
8.8.10.6
Instrucción REPEAT-UNTIL................................................................................................. 314
8.8.10.7
Instrucción CONTINUE...................................................................................................... 315
8.8.10.8
Instrucción EXIT ............................................................................................................... 315
8.8.10.9
Instrucción GOTO............................................................................................................. 316
8.8.10.10
Instrucción RETURN.......................................................................................................... 316
8.9
Operaciones lógicas con palabras..................................................................................... 317
8.9.1
Instrucciones de operaciones lógicas AND, OR y XOR ........................................................ 317
8.9.2
INV (complemento a 1) .................................................................................................... 318
8.9.3
Instrucciones DECO (Descodificar) y ENCO (Codificar)........................................................ 318
8.9.4
8.10
Desplazamiento y rotación ............................................................................................... 322
8.10.1
8.10.2
9
Instrucciones avanzadas.................................................................................................................... 325
9.1
Funciones de fecha, hora y reloj ....................................................................................... 325
9.1.1
Instrucciones de fecha y hora ........................................................................................... 325
9.1.2
Funciones de reloj............................................................................................................ 328
9.1.3
Estructura de datos TimeTransformationRule .................................................................... 330
9.1.4
SET_TIMEZONE (ajustar zona horaria)............................................................................... 331
9.1.5
RTM (contador de horas de funcionamiento) .................................................................... 332
9.2
Cadena y carácter ............................................................................................................ 334
9.2.1
Sinopsis del tipo de datos String ....................................................................................... 334
9.2.2
S_MOVE (desplazar cadena de caracteres) ........................................................................ 335
Controlador programable S7-1200
Manual de sistema, V4.5 05/2021, A5E02486683-AO
Índice
11

Hide quick links:

Publicidad

Tabla de contenido
loading

Tabla de contenido